Why become an Eye Promise Member?
Eye Promise is a national mark of distinction created by the Association for Independent Optometrists and Dispensing Opticians (AIO), designed to help the public identify practices that offer the highest quality of eye care. AIO as an independent body is passionate about promoting the importance of thorough, regular eye examinations, will ensure all Eye Promise subscribers live up to the Eye Promise quality mark.
By subscribing to Eye Promise, you are showing your long-term commitment to providing quality eye care to all of your patients.
Until now, we believe that it is fair to say that members of the public were not generally aware of the differing levels of eye care and service that different opticians offer. We hope to change this with Eye Promise.

How much does it cost to become an Eye Promise Member?
Joining Eye Promise is free, however you would first need to sign up to become an AIO member – this ranges in price from £100 to £300 per annum depending on how many qualified practitioners you would like covered (for AIO student and retired members this is between £10 and £50).
